TLP293-4(V4-LA,E Details

  • Manufacturer Part Number:

    TLP293-4(V4-LA,E

  • Rohs Code:

    Yes

  • Part Life Cycle Code:

    Active

  • Package Description:

    SOP-16

  • ECCN Code:

    3A001.a.2.c

  • HTS Code:

    8541.40.80.00

  • Factory Lead Time:

    14 Weeks

  • Manufacturer:

    Toshiba America Electronic Components

  • YTEOL:

    8

  • Additional Feature:

    UL RECOGNIZED, VDE APPROVED

  • Coll-Emtr Bkdn Voltage-Min:

    80 V

  • Configuration:

    SEPARATE, 4 CHANNELS

  • Current Transfer Ratio-Min:

    50%

  • Dark Current-Max:

    80 nA

  • Forward Current-Max:

    0.05 A

  • Forward Voltage-Max:

    1.4 V

  • Isolation Voltage-Max:

    3750 V

  • Mounting Feature:

    SURFACE MOUNT

  • Number of Elements:

    4

  • On-State Current-Max:

    0.05 A

  • Operating Temperature-Max:

    125 °C

  • Operating Temperature-Min:

    -55 °C

  • Optoelectronic Device Type:

    TRANSISTOR OUTPUT OPTOCOUPLER

  • Power Dissipation-Max:

    0.1 W

  • Response Time-Max:

    0.000002 s

  • Surface Mount:

    YES
